Consul General of Italy in Karachi, Danilo Giurdanella inaugurates 7th edition of the Italian Design Week at Habitt City.

The Consul General of Italy Danilo Giurdanella welcomed the guests at the 7th edition of the Italian Design Week in Karachi on Thursday, 16 March, 2023 jointly organized by the Consulate of Italy with Habitt City – a community safe space for cultural initiatives and activities for Karachiites.

The event was organized to launch Don Corleone Objects in Pakistan by the renowned Sicilian ceramic artist, Antonino Forlin. Antonino Forlin and IBL/Habitt CEO, Munis Abdullah ventured together for a retail launch of the signature home textile and ceramic collections namely ‘Taormina’ and “Munis × Don Corleone” in Pakistan.

The event was attended by diplomats, foreigners, government-officials, prominent-architects, artists, selected members of press and notable members of business community. Some of attendees were Commissioner Karachi Mr. Iqbal Memon, Consul General of United States of America Ms. Nicole Theriot, Consul General of France Mr. Alexis Chahtahtinsky, Consul General of Japan Mr. Odagiri Toshio, Chairman Gul Ahmed Textile Mills, Mr. Bashir Ali Mohammad and many more.

The Italian Design Day is an event conceived to promote Italian design abroad, to support exports and the internationalization of companies in this sector, to foster international know-how and exchange of technical and creative skills. This 7th edition focuses on quality, the ability to conceive and create products that combine aesthetic and functional needs using production processes that respect the environment and people’s health.

Besides the product launches of Taormina and Munis × Don Corleone collections in Karachi, the Consulate also organized the book launch and panel discussion of The FOLD – a book by Salman Jawaid, the first Pakistani architect invited in 2018 by the European Culture Centre to organize the Pakistan Pavilion at the International Venice Architecture Biennale, which created history for the people of Pakistan and opened the doors for others to follow. The book looks into the journey of a team of young passionate architects from Pakistan, who make a mark at one of the most prestigious international design event with their sheer determination and hard-work.

The Consulate together with Habitt City have lined up cultural events such as an Italian Markitt – a three day street food festival from 17-19 March, 2023 for people of Karachi to enjoy the Italian delicacies in their city. Furthermore, a ceramic workshop by Antonino Forlin has been organized for arts enthusiasts and students to get a chance to learn specialized technique and methods used in pottery and ceramics. An Italian Culinary Class has also been organized for ardent lovers of Italian cuisine to learn authentic Italian recipes, which will be demonstrated by Chef Gennaro Carrozza during the Italian Design Week.

The Italian Friends of the Citizen Foundation, a non-profit organization advocating the cause of TCF Pakistan in Italy has partnered with Indus Valley School for Art and Architecture and Salone del Mobile, the largest Annual Furniture and Design Exhibition in the world hosted in Milan. Dr. Faiza Mushtaq, Executive Director & Dean of Academics at IVS School of Art and Architecture took the opportunity to announce on the occasion of Italian Design Day, the ART4EDUCATION project, that aims to showcase award winning design pieces by Pakistani artists, architects and designers to be auctioned at Salone del Mobile in 2024 to support the TCF network in Pakistan.

Style Textile tops Pakistan’s Top Exporters List.

List of Pakistan’s top 100 Exporters was released last week and us usual this year’s top exporters list also had no surprises, as it was dominated by textile sector. Almost 70% of the contributors were from textile-sector. All of the top 10 exporters were also from textile-sector with seven of them from Karachi, two from Lahore and one from Faisalabad. These top 100 Exporters effected a contribution of $10.36 billion to country’s economy. Rice-sector with 9% contribution on the list came second and contributed around $700 million to national treasury.

Lahore based Style Textile topped the export-sales list for second consecutive year with export-sales amounting to $428 million. Last year their export-sales stood at $333 million. This shows an increase of 33% from their last year’s figures.

Interloop from Faisalabad jumped from sixth spot (last year) to reach second (this year) with the figures of $331 million export-sales. This also shows a very significant increase of 55% from their last year’s figures of $214 million.

Artistic Milliners stood their ground by gaining third position for second consecutive year. They bettered their previous year’s exports-sales from $278 million to $329 million, which accounted to an increase of 18%.

Yunus Textile Mills bagged fourth position with export-sales of $311 million this year. Last year they were at $221 million and this year they managed to increase their export-sales by a wide margin of 41%.

Nishat Mills Limited with export-sales of $307 million dropped from last year’s second position to fifth position this year. Last year, they managed $291 million.

Gul Ahmed Textile Mills was also on the list of achievers. They jumped from eighth position to sixth position. Their figures rose by 39% from last year’s $205 million to $284 million this year.

Feroz 1888 Mills Limited with export-sales of $273 million this year bagged seventh position and rose by 38% from their last year’s figures of $198 million.  

Soorty Enterprises Limited dropped from fourth position down to eighth position. Their year’s sales figures stood at $268 million against their last year’s figures of $259 million showing a difference of 3% only.

Artistic Fabrics & Garments Industries bettered their last year’s sales figure by 20%. This year their export-sales figures stood at $226 million against their last year’s export-sales figures of $189 million.

Liberty Textile Mills managed to jump into top ten by capturing the last available slot. They bettered their stats by 25% and managed to bag $216 million against their last year’s figure of $173 million.

Novatex (plastic-chips manufacturer) and Garibsons (rice-sector) are the only two exporters in top-twenty list not hailing from the dominant textile-sector. Novatex with $167 million stood at sixteenth position and Garibsons with $165 million bagged eighteenth position.

Rice sector had nine(09) contributors in the list followed by three (03) from cement-sector, two(02) each from steel-sector, oil-gas-sector and chemical-sector. One each contributor from plastic-sector, pharmaceutical-sector, ethanol, herb, spices, logistics, IT services and surgical goods completed the list.
